Definitions:

Medicaid

A joint federal and state program that helps with medical costs for some people with limited income and resources.

Disabled Persons

Individuals who have a physical, mental, intellectual, or sensory impairment which, in interaction with various barriers, may hinder their full and effective participation in society on an equal basis with others.

Federal Level

Pertaining to the national government or aspects of governance that involve the entire country as opposed to local or state levels.

Aid Program

Initiatives designed to provide financial or material assistance to individuals, groups, or countries in need, often administered by governments or charitable organizations.
